THE EDITOR, Sir:

With the passage of Hurricane Sandy, much needs to be done by big organisations like the banks to partner with the Government in fixing and maintaining the roadways and other areas. The Government cannot do it alone.

A case in point is that strip of roadway by Scotiabank and National Commercial Bank in the Half-Way Tree area. Whenever there is a heavy downpour of rain, it is like a sea.

Each year, businesses boast of the big profits they make. They could go on a mission and help in the rebuilding of the country.

CLAUDETTE HARRIS
